Crc Press Cyber Careers The Basics Of Information Technology And Deciding On A Career Path 09781032068442

The approach taken in this book emphasizes the basics of information technology and helps students decide whether to pursue an information technology career. Most students fail to pursue an IT career because of their limited knowledge (sometimes no knowledge) about the area. Similarly most students pursuing a career in IT do not research the field before their pursuit. This book is purposely designed for students in this category. The book may be offered as a required text for an elective or core course to all bachelor's degree students regardless of specialization. Compared to other textbooks this text guides students pursuing or wanting to pursue an IT degree/career. Most students often begin their study of IT without knowing the outside and inside of the area. Most of these students can change their minds to pursue a different career path after spending several semesters of studies a waste of their time. If students are taught from the onset about what an IT career entails and what it takes to become successful it will significantly help students and not waste their time. This book addresses the issue. | Cyber Careers The Basics of Information Technology and Deciding on a Career Path
